    elimination
    /ɪˌlɪmɪˈneɪʃn/

    noun

    • 1. the complete removal or destruction of something: "the elimination of extreme poverty is a key objective"
    • 2. the expulsion of waste matter from the body: "the treatment promotes the elimination of toxins"
